From: Petr S. <pst...@so...> - 2004-11-29 21:35:40
|
Laurent Vogel p=ED=B9e v Po 29. 11. 2004 v 22:11 +0100: > - immediately: do not set the '_SND' and '_VDO' cookies to anything=20 > other than PSG sound and STe shifter, but keep the values of=20 > the _MCH cookie. > - in the near future, implement the VIDEL XBIOS routines, and then allo= w=20 > setting '_VDO' to 0x00030000. I agree 100%. > One could argue whether it is worse to have e.g. _MCH and _SND in > conflict, or to report advanced _SND features without the corresponding= =20 > XBIOS functions. I believe it is worse to lie about the XBIOS functions. Definitely. For example, current FreeMiNT kernel sort of fails on ARAnyM +EmuTOS because it tries to call a Falcon XBIOS function (because of the _VDO value) but the function is not available (IIRC). Petr |